What Are Full Mouth Dental Implants?

Full mouth dental implants are a revolutionary solution for individuals who have lost very or all of their natural teeth. These implants are designed to provide a good and stable foundation for artificial teeth, allowing patients to regain their smile and functionality. Unlike traditional dentures, full mouth implants offer enhanced comfort, improved chewing ability, and a natural appearance.

The Cost of Full Mouth Dental Implants

The cost of full mouth dental implants can vary significantly based on several factors, including the location of the dental practice, the complexity of the case, and the materials used. On average, the cost ranges from $20,000 to $30,000 for a complete set of implants. However, there are affordable dental implants options near you that can help reduce these expenses.

Factors Influencing the Cost

  • Location: Dental practices in metropolitan areas typically charge more due to higher overhead costs.
  • Type of Implant: There are different types of implants, such as traditional and mini implants, which can affect the overall price.
  • Additional Procedures: Some patients may require bone grafting or sinus lifting, which can add to the total cost.
  • Experience of the Dentist: Highly experienced dental professionals often charge more for their expertise.

Full Dental Implants in One Day

For those seeking a quicker solution, many dental clinics now offer full dental implants in one day. This process, often referred to as "teeth in a day," allows patients to leave the clinic with a complete set of teeth the same day they undergo the procedure. This option is particularly appealing for individuals who want to avoid the long waiting periods associated with traditional implants.

The Process of Getting Full Mouth Implants

The process for full mouth dental implants typically involves several steps:

  1. Initial Consultation: A thorough examination and discussion of your dental history and goals.
  2. Treatment Planning: Developing a personalized treatment plan based on your specific needs.
  3. Implant Placement: The surgical placement of the implants into the jawbone, which may take a few hours.
  4. Healing Period: Allowing time for the implants to integrate with the bone, which can take several months.
  5. Abutment Placement: Once healed, abutments are attached to the implants to hold the final crowns.
  6. Crown Placement: The final prosthetic teeth are placed, completing the process.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How long do full mouth dental implants last?

With proper care and maintenance, full mouth dental implants can last a lifetime. Regular dental check-ups and good oral hygiene are crucial.

2. Are dental implants painful?

Very patients report minimal discomfort during and after the procedure. Anesthesia and pain management options are available to ensure comfort.

3. Can anyone get dental implants?

Very people are candidates for dental implants, but individuals with certain health conditions or inadequate bone density may require additional procedures.
